FAIL (the browser should render some flash content, not this).

No Images

 

NEW VENT INFO IS BELOW


IP: 72.51.60.188


PORT: 4534


PASSWORD: NO PASSWORD

FAIL (the browser should render some flash content, not this).
Official PayPal Seal